Hastings (Hal) Clawson (1874-1912) was the manager of magician Will B. Wood, including for his final tragic tour of Mexico in 1908.

Biography

He later managed Frederick Eugene Powell and briefly toured vaudeville with the Wood's famous "Edna" levitation.

Richard Hatch is his great-nephew.
